Houston Artists Dan Havel and Dean Ruck moved an old home onto an empty lot on Lyons Ave and turned it into a pretty cool work of art. After using recycled materials to make the house look partially turned inside out and adding a stage it is now a publicly accessible park and community meeting place. This shot of the Gaillard-Mitchell Family Cemetery was taken on today's BPC field trip. It's a single shot "pseudo" HDR conversion in Photomatix taken with a fish eye lens on my Olympus E-5. The wall around the cemetery is actually square, the perspective distortion is a result of the fish eye optics.
